Very few upgrades have changed my daily routine as much as adding a home solar battery. Before installing energy storage, my rooftop solar panels produced plenty of electricity during the afternoon, but I still bought power from the grid every evening. Now the battery stores excess solar energy and runs much of my home after sunset.
The biggest difference shows up during peak-hour billing. I used to see my electricity meter climb between 5 and 9 p.m., especially when cooking dinner, running the dishwasher, and charging devices. With the battery set to discharge during those hours, my grid usage has dropped noticeably. My monthly bill is usually around 25–35% lower, depending on weather and how much heating or cooling we use. I am not completely energy independent, but seeing the battery carry the house through the evening feels genuinely satisfying.

I normally keep the battery above 20% rather than draining it completely, which gives me some backup capacity overnight.
One small troubleshooting moment happened during a cloudy week. The battery stopped discharging automatically, even though the app showed enough stored energy. After checking the settings, I found that the time-of-use schedule had reset after a software update. I restored the peak-hour schedule, and the system resumed normal operation the following evening.
For me, the main benefit is not just saving money. It is using more of my own solar power instead of exporting it cheaply and buying electricity back later at a higher rate. The battery has made our solar installation feel much more practical day to day, particularly during expensive evening hours.
